Featuring air-conditioned accommodation with a balcony, Axin homestay is located in Hue. The property features garden views and is 1.9 km from Trang Tien Bridge and 2.5 km from Dong Ba Market. There is a terrace and guests can make use of free WiFi, free private parking and an electric vehicle charging station.

The spacious holiday home is composed of 5 bedrooms, a living room, a fully equipped kitchen, and 6 bathrooms. A flat-screen TV is provided.

Museum of Royal Antiquities is 3.4 km from the holiday home, while Forbidden Purple City is 4.3 km away. Phu Bai International Airport is 13 km from the property.


The hotel day starts from hour 14:00 and ends at 12:00.
